This Week On #MediaBuzz
BEN CARSON said he shouldn't have taken the bait in criticizing Donald Trump and that he won't be throwing more punches in this campaign. SHARYL ATTKISSON said the media demand apologies from Trump but not from those who attack Trump. STEVE HAYES called The Donald an egomaniac and not a serious candidate. DANA MILBANK said Hillary aides who told the press she'd be warmer and funnier should be fired. LAURA INGRAHAM said conservative pundits attacking Trump are missing his appeal on such topics as immigration and trade. And STEPHEN BATTAGLIO said Stephen Colbert's heavy focus on politics could help the new "Late Show."

I was deeply offended by a comment Steve Hayes made this morning 09/13/15. He stated Mr. Trump has no substance and a percentage of the people support him and don't care that he does not have substance. Mr. Hayes, you have insulted my intelligence. I am a college graduate and have been a police officer for 19 years. I do believe in substance. Mr. Trump has given the same amount of substance as any other candidate.

About the Show
Our new media program analyzes the coverage of a wide range of topics, including technology, social media, politics, culture and sports. Our panelists debate the week’s hottest press issues and top journalists join us for in-depth interviews.
